Briefly tell how the pages of the SSG are organized.

What will be an ideal response?


Page one

*General information on the company (at top of the page)
*Recent quarterly sales and earning figures (in box)
*Section 1: Visual Analysis-graph for charting sales, earnings per share, and price

Page two
*Section 2: Evaluating Management-gives trends in two key financial ratios
*Section 3: Price-Earnings History-to help you calculate the price to earnings ratio
*Section 4: Evaluating Risk and Reward-critical to determining whether you should buy a particular stock
*Section 5: 5-Year Potential-for estimating the potential 5-year return in the future

Pages three and four
*Contain eight questions to help you determine whether a stock is an appropriate purchase based on your goals
